French Grand Prix receives FIA three-star environmental certification

The organisers of the Formula One French Grand Prix has today announced that the venue has received the highest level of environmental certification from the FIA. With the certification, the governing body recognizes the dedication and work of the Formula 1 Grand Prix de France which has been diligent and dedicated to work on an ambitious sustainable programme. The French GP organisers’ efforts included reducing the consumption of raw materials, favouring the use of biofuel-based energy sources, the use of sustainable materials and the elimination of single-use plastics.
